Finance Review Summary — Training Budget, Next Fiscal Year

Prepared for the heads of department. The proposed training allocation rises eight percent, driven mainly by the Larkspur certification program and expanded onboarding at the Dunmere site. Travel-linked training is trimmed in favor of facilitated remote cohorts. Department caps remain unchanged pending the December review. Please weigh your requests against the strategic direction noted confidentially below.

confidential, tagep-yahag: Headcount on the Oliael team goes from 5 to 100 by the end of July. Gross margin on Oliael came in at 20 percent against a plan of 15 percent.

Welcome to on-call for the Glimmerpane design system! Our snapshot tests live in the `snapcheck` suite and run on every merge to main. If a UI component changes visually, the diff bot flags it — usually it's an intentional tweak, so just approve the new baseline. If it's 2am and snapshots are failing across the board, it's almost always a font-loading race, not your problem. To unlock the baseline store and re-approve snapshots in bulk, use the recovery passphrase below.

recovery phrase for tahag-taguf: wenix-caswyn

Step 4: Enable the bloom filter ahead of the Pellstone KV store. Set `bloom.enabled=true` in the Quirrel gateway config, then verify false-positive rate stays under 1% on the Harkwell dashboard. Do not roll forward if lookup latency regresses. Redeploying the gateway requires a signed manifest. Sign the rollout bundle with the release key shown below.

rollout seal: bky4_DFM9